Chocolate Syrups: Exploring the Essential Elements

Chocolate Syrups play a critical role in the mocha experience. They provide the foundational chocolate flavor, adding richness, complexity, and sweetness to the coffee base.

Key Aspects:

  • Flavor Profile: From classic bittersweet to dark chocolate, milk chocolate, or even caramel notes, the range of flavors is vast.
  • Sweetness Level: Syrups vary in sweetness, impacting the overall taste of the mocha.
  • Ingredients: Natural syrups with minimal processing are preferred by many, while others seek convenient options with longer shelf lives.
  • Consistency: Thick syrups offer a richer chocolate experience, while thinner syrups blend seamlessly with the coffee.

FAQs by Chocolate Syrup for Mocha

Introduction: This section addresses common questions about choosing the best chocolate syrup for your mocha.

Questions:

  1. What is the difference between chocolate syrup and chocolate sauce? Chocolate syrup is typically thinner and designed for beverages, while chocolate sauce is thicker and intended for desserts.
  2. Can I use chocolate syrup in other drinks besides mocha? Absolutely! Chocolate syrup can be used in hot chocolate, milkshakes, and even cocktails.
  3. What makes a chocolate syrup high quality? Look for syrups made with natural ingredients, a rich chocolate flavor, and a smooth, consistent texture.
  4. Can I make my own chocolate syrup? Yes! There are many recipes available online, allowing you to control the ingredients and sweetness level.
  5. How long does chocolate syrup last? Unopened chocolate syrup can last for several months, while opened syrup should be refrigerated and consumed within a few weeks.
  6. What is the best way to store chocolate syrup? Store it in a cool, dark place or refrigerate it after opening to maintain its freshness.

Tips for the Perfect Mocha with Chocolate Syrup

Introduction: These tips can help you create the ultimate mocha experience with the right chocolate syrup.

Tips:

  1. Use high-quality coffee: A strong, flavorful coffee base enhances the chocolate syrup's notes.
  2. Adjust the sweetness: Add a touch of sweetener to your mocha if you prefer a sweeter taste.
  3. Experiment with different milks: From dairy milk to almond or soy milk, different milk options can influence the flavor profile.
  4. Add a touch of spice: A sprinkle of cinnamon or nutmeg can enhance the warmth and complexity of the mocha.
  5. Don't over-pour: Adding too much chocolate syrup can overpower the coffee flavor.
